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ities at Swale Train Station

Despite lacking a ticket office, Swale Train Station is equipped with ticket machines for seamless travel bookings and collections. These machines cater to all, including accessibility for disabled travelers as they're conveniently located by the entrance to platform 1. With the absence of smartcard facilities, travelers benefit from traditional ticketing methods and innovative online purchase options, ensuring they're set for their journey with no hassle.

Travelers seeking assistance will find help points at the station alongside information via departure screens and announcements. While Swale doesn’t have a manned information desk, Southeastern Customer Services is just a phone call away at 0345 322 7021. CCTV surveillance ensures the safety and security of the station’s premises.

An Accessible Journey

The station provides step-free access, making it partially amenable for those with mobility issues. Although Swale is unstaffed, there are trained staff present on trains to aid in the boarding and alighting process, along with a mobile Assistance Team ready to ensure all customers are catered to. The facility lacks amenities like waiting rooms, refreshments, or restrooms, calling for a more streamlined experience focused solely on transit.

Facilities and Services

Bearsted Train Station is equipped to meet a variety of traveler needs, offering a good range of facilities for maximum convenience. If you need to purchase tickets, the station's ticket office is open Monday to Friday from 06:10 to 19:30, Saturday from 07:10 to 13:50, and Sunday from 07:40 to 15:10. For those with online tickets, collection is hassle-free at the ticket machine, which is conveniently accessible on Platform 1 for those with mobility impairments.

Travelers can find amenities such as toilets in the booking hall, available during staffing hours, with fully accessible toilets for travelers requiring step-free access. Meanwhile, refreshments are available at a coffee kiosk on site, although you'll need to plan ahead for other shopping needs as there are no shops or ATMs at the station.

Accessibility

The station earns a Category A rating for accessibility. This means it provides step-free access throughout, including lifts and ramps to assist anyone with mobility restrictions. While there aren’t wheelchair services directly available or dedicated accessible taxis, there are three accessible parking spaces on the premises operated by APCOA Parking. Be sure to contact Southeastern Customer Services for any specific assistance before your travel.

Onward Travel Options

Once you arrive at Bearsted, there's more than one way to continue your journey. The station serves as a hub with bus services connecting travelers to key areas like Ashford, with a bus stop located just outside the station car park, referenced under the What3Words location "panel.cheat.tins". For those heading towards Maidstone, the bus stop is conveniently located across the street, accessible under "become.lifted.almost". Unfortunately, no local cycle hire services are available, so consider buses or car hire for your onward adventures.
